What you'll be doing:
- Effectively oversee the entire incident management lifecycle, encompassing recording, categorisation, investigation, and resolution.
- Guarantee timely resolution of incidents in adherence to service level agreements (SLAs).
- Foster efficient communication among customers, service desk personnel, and technical teams for swift incident resolution.
- Recognise, prioritise, and promptly escalate critical incidents demanding immediate attention.
- Formulate and uphold comprehensive incident management procedures and policies.
- Supervise both the incident management process and the team members involved in resolution efforts.
- Generate insightful reports on incident management performance and emerging trends.
- Ensure meticulous documentation of all incidents.
- Identify and implement necessary changes for continual improvement in the incident management process.
